About

Mottingham is a residential suburb in the London Borough of Bromley, bordering the Royal Borough of Greenwich. The area is characterised by a mix of housing, primarily inter-war and post-war semi-detached homes, with some modern developments and older terraced properties. It is served by a local high street with essential shops and services, catering mainly to day-to-day needs.

The area includes several green spaces, such as the grounds of the former Mottingham Manor. A notable local feature is the Royal Blackheath Golf Club, which extends into the area and is one of the oldest golf clubs in England. Transport links are provided by Mottingham railway station, offering services into central London, reinforcing its role as a commuter settlement within the wider southeastern suburbs.

Area overview

On average Mottingham has high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 105 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 29.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Mottingham is £64,454 per year. There are 4 schools in Mottingham: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 3 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). On average most houses in area has low public transport connectivity. Mottingham is home to around 9,330 people, with a population density of about 4,192.1 per km2.

Property prices in Mottingham

Based on 74 recent sales, the median property price is £400,000 in Mottingham area, with individual transactions ranging from £190,000 up to £1,300,000.
